Jam tart with easy recipe
The jam tart is by far the dessert I prepare most often. I like to vary the taste of the jam, the shape of the cake or the type of shortcrust pastry used. This time I used a shortcrust pastry without butter, easy and without pitfalls, but if you want you can follow our classic recipe. For celiacs, it is advisable to follow the gluten-free tart recipe. Very few ingredients will be enough to prepare a cake loved by young and old. Excellent for breakfast or as a snack jam tart it’s also great if you want to bring something you make yourself when you’re invited to dinner.
Ingredients for 8 people
- flour: 00: 250 g
- seed oil: 35 g
- extra virgin olive oil: 35 g
- sugar: 125 g
- water: 65 g
- yeast sachet: 1
- jam jar: 1
- Preparation: 15 minutes
- Cooking: 35 minutes
- Total: 50 minutes
- Calories: 320 kcal
Preparation
In a bowl, dissolve the sugar in the water. Then add the two types of oil and create an emulsion by beating with a fork.
Then add the flour and baking powder and mix quickly with a spoon.
Then transfer it to a floured surface and form a loaf, working it quickly. Wrap it in cling film and leave it in the refrigerator for at least an hour, the ideal would be a whole night.
Then with the help of a sheet of parchment paper, roll it out to a thickness of half a centimeter. I usually use a sheet of cling film placed on top so the rolling pin doesn’t stick to the dough.
Then transfer everything, complete with parchment paper, to the tart pan. Trim the edges and set aside the leftover dough for decorations.
Prick the bottom with a fork and pour the jam jar leveling well.
Decorate with the leftover dough, obtaining shapes as you like.
Bake at 180 ° C for 35 minutes.
